The House Where Nobody Lives is a heartfelt story of a man who returns to his childhood home in Buffalo, New York, to find it abandoned and falling apart. Inside he meets a brother and sister using the abandoned house for temporary shelter trying to make their way back home the only way they know how. The play addresses racial issues and stereotypes and the realities of what can happen when confronted with them. How will these three individuals be impacted by the racism they face every day? Will they ever find home?
